So I noticed on my official transcript, it lists "Summer 2014" as a term with no courses. I vaguely remember it. I signed up for a summer course but withdrew a week before the term began, so I never attended the class or anything like that. The class isn't even listed on my transcript (I don't even remember what it was, my guess is a lab), but the term (Summer 2014) IS listed, and it says the withdraw date, with no course, no credits attempted, nothing. So, I didn't list this term on my TMDSAS because I didn't even remember it and there's nothing to list. Is that okay? What should I list on my AMCAS? There's no course or credits or anything, just "Summer 2014, withdrew", and a value of 0.000 for credits attempted, earned, etc.

I withdraw before the course even began, but I'm concerned they might think I took a class, withdrew, and somehow got it "expunged" from my record or something.
